1#!/usr/bin/env python
2#
3# Copyright 2004 Matt Mackall <mpm@selenic.com>
4#
5# Inspired by perl Bloat-O-Meter (c) 1997 by Andi Kleen
6#
7# This software may be used and distributed according to the terms
8# of the GNU General Public License, incorporated herein by reference.
9
10import sys, os#, re
11
12def usage():
13 sys.stderr.write("usage: %s [-t] file1 file2\n" % sys.argv[0])
14 sys.exit(-1)
15
16f1, f2 = (None, None)
17flag_timing, dashes = (False, False)
18
19for f in sys.argv[1:]:
20 if f.startswith("-"):
21 if f == "--": # sym_args
22 dashes = True
23 break
24 if f == "-t": # timings
25 flag_timing = True
26 else:
27 if not os.path.exists(f):
28 sys.stderr.write("Error: file '%s' does not exist\n" % f)
29 usage()
30 if f1 is None:
31 f1 = f
32 elif f2 is None:
33 f2 = f
34if flag_timing:
35 import time
36if f1 is None or f2 is None:
37 usage()
38
39sym_args = " ".join(sys.argv[3 + flag_timing + dashes:])
40def getsizes(file):
41 sym, alias, lut = {}, {}, {}
42 for l in os.popen("readelf -W -s %s %s" % (sym_args, file)).readlines():
43 l = l.strip()
44 if not (len(l) and l[0].isdigit() and len(l.split()) == 8):
45 continue
46 num, value, size, typ, bind, vis, ndx, name = l.split()
47 if ndx == "UND": continue # skip undefined
48 if typ in ["SECTION", "FILES"]: continue # skip sections and files
49 if "." in name: name = "static." + name.split(".")[0]
50 value = int(value, 16)
51 size = int(size, 16) if size.startswith('0x') else int(size)
52 if vis != "DEFAULT" and bind != "GLOBAL": # see if it is an alias
53 alias[(value, size)] = {"name" : name}
54 else:
55 sym[name] = {"addr" : value, "size": size}
56 lut[(value, size)] = 0
57 for addr, sz in iter(alias.keys()):
58 # If the non-GLOBAL sym has an implementation elsewhere then
59 # it's an alias, disregard it.
60 if not (addr, sz) in lut:
61 # If this non-GLOBAL sym does not have an implementation at
62 # another address, then treat it as a normal symbol.
63 sym[alias[(addr, sz)]["name"]] = {"addr" : addr, "size": sz}
64 for l in os.popen("readelf -W -S " + file).readlines():
65 x = l.split()
66 if len(x)<6: continue
67 # Should take these into account too!
68 #if x[1] not in [".text", ".rodata", ".symtab", ".strtab"]: continue
69 if x[1] not in [".rodata"]: continue
70 sym[x[1]] = {"addr" : int(x[3], 16), "size" : int(x[5], 16)}
71 return sym
72
73if flag_timing:
74 start_t1 = int(time.time() * 1e9)
75old = getsizes(f1)
76if flag_timing:
77 end_t1 = int(time.time() * 1e9)
78 start_t2 = int(time.time() * 1e9)
79new = getsizes(f2)
80if flag_timing:
81 end_t2 = int(time.time() * 1e9)
82 start_t3 = int(time.time() * 1e9)
83grow, shrink, add, remove, up, down = 0, 0, 0, 0, 0, 0
84delta, common = [], {}
85
86for name in iter(old.keys()):
87 if name in new:
88 common[name] = 1
89
90for name in old:
91 if name not in common:
92 remove += 1
93 sz = old[name]["size"]
94 down += sz
95 delta.append((-sz, name))
96
97for name in new:
98 if name not in common:
99 add += 1
100 sz = new[name]["size"]
101 up += sz
102 delta.append((sz, name))
103
104for name in common:
105 d = new[name].get("size", 0) - old[name].get("size", 0)
106 if d>0: grow, up = grow+1, up+d
107 elif d<0: shrink, down = shrink+1, down-d
108 else:
109 continue
110 delta.append((d, name))
111
112delta.sort()
113delta.reverse()
114if flag_timing:
115 end_t3 = int(time.time() * 1e9)
116
117print("%-48s %7s %7s %+7s" % ("function", "old", "new", "delta"))
118for d, n in delta:
119 if d:
120 old_sz = old.get(n, {}).get("size", "-")
121 new_sz = new.get(n, {}).get("size", "-")
122 print("%-48s %7s %7s %+7d" % (n, old_sz, new_sz, d))
123print("-"*78)
124total="(add/remove: %s/%s grow/shrink: %s/%s up/down: %s/%s)%%sTotal: %s bytes"\
125 % (add, remove, grow, shrink, up, -down, up-down)
126print(total % (" "*(80-len(total))))
127if flag_timing:
128 print("\n%d/%d; %d Parse origin/new; processing nsecs" %
129 (end_t1-start_t1, end_t2-start_t2, end_t3-start_t3))
130 print("total nsecs: %d" % (end_t3-start_t1))
